Digital Desk: The first government Orchid Park in Kaziranga National Park will be opened for domestic and international tourists. The Government Orchid Park will be opened in the latter part of the year 2025. This was confirmed by the Agriculture Minister, Atul Bora, in Kaziranga. 

He inspected the ongoing construction work of the government Orchid Park in Kaziranga. 

Along with Atul Bora, Minister Keshab Mahanta also accompanied him on this visit. 

The Orchid Park is being constructed on approximately 20 acres of land in Kohora, Kaziranga, under the initiative of the Horticulture Department. 

It is worth mentioning that on July 16, 2020, the foundation stone for the government Orchid Park was laid by then Assam Chief Minister Sarbananda Sonowal. 

However, allegations were made that the construction of the park was moving very slowly. Notably, Rs 16 crore have been allocated for this project. 

A company named Darjeeling Garden is carrying out the construction work of the government Orchid Park. 

Although it was planned to be opened in July, due to the monsoon season causing some delays in the work, the park will now be opened towards the end of the year.
